The Importance of a Balanced Diet
A balanced diet is crucial for health and wellbeing. It provides the essential nutrients needed for the body to function effectively, supporting the immune system, promoting healing, and helping manage certain health conditions. Lack of proper nutrition can lead to weakness, illness, longer healing times, and overall diminished wellbeing.
Dietary Guidelines for Home Health Care Patients
Dietary needs can vary depending on an individual’s health status, age, weight, and lifestyle. However, most health care professionals recommend a diet consisting of fruits, vegetables, whole grains, lean proteins, and healthy fats.
Customizing Nutrition to Manage Health Conditions
Different health conditions may require specific dietary adjustments. For example, a heart-healthy diet is low in sodium and saturated fats. On the other hand, diabetic patients need to monitor their carbohydrate intake. Your healthcare team can provide guidance in customizing your diet to manage your specific health needs.
Planning Meals and Snacks
Meal planning can be an effective tool to ensure balanced nutrition. It can also make it easier to maintain a healthy diet while juggling personal care and health management. Plan your meals and snacks in advance, ensuring they’re balanced, varied, and enjoyable so you’re more likely to stick to your diet plan.
Seeking Professional Guidance
If you’re feeling overwhelmed about diet planning, a registered dietitian can provide valuable guidance and support. They can design a tailored plan to accommodate your dietary needs and preferences while helping you manage your health condition.
